While modest in size, Mortimer train station is adequately equipped to cater to your essential travel needs. The station operates a ticket office during weekdays from 06:30 to 13:00 and on Saturdays from 07:30 to 14:00. Although there's no Sunday service, ticket machines are on hand for your convenience and they’re accessible for all passengers. Keep in mind that while smartcards can be issued, validators are not available. Strategically placed help points offer information and support, ensuring your travel is as smooth as possible without the need for luggage storage or lost property facilities.
Accessibility is a priority at Mortimer. Though not completely step-free, the station is classified as Category B3 with some step-free access on northbound services. Assistance is readily available during staffed hours, and customer help points are ready to guide travelers optimally. CCTV surveillance adds an extra layer of security for peace of mind. While no accessible toilets are available, there is a waiting room on Platform 2, with ample seating throughout.
For those driving, APCOA Parking operates a station car park that is open 24 hours, offering 50 spaces at competitive rates. Blue badge holders enjoy free parking, although there’s only one accessible space. Cyclists are also welcomed with secure cycle lockers and stands, with CCTV ensuring bike security.

Despite its compact size, Bosham train station ensures passengers have access to necessary facilities. Operating from 06:10 to 10:25 on weekdays, the ticket office provides a personalized touch for travelers. For your convenience, there's a ticket machine available 24/7 where tickets purchased online can be collected. The station is equipped with smartcard issuance and validation, supporting efficient travel with modern technology.
Accessibility is a priority here. With step-free access and staff assistance during operating hours, the station caters to travelers with disabilities. However, ticket machines' locations, while accessible in design, may not perfectly align with the station's architecture, so checking the station map is advised before visiting. For additional aid, staff are usually available Monday to Friday, assisting with boarding trains and navigating the platforms. If you're traveling with a Disabled Persons Railcard, you'll be pleased to know that discounts are available at the ticket machines. Parking is free, with spaces for 15 vehicles and one designated accessible space. Cycling enthusiasts will appreciate the bicycle storage on Platform 2 and in the car park, although cycling hire is not available on site.
